About The Role

We’re looking for a Senior Human–Robot Interaction (HRI) Designer who can define how people naturally communicate and collaborate with our humanoid robots. You’ll shape behaviors, motion cues, UI, and the overall interaction patterns that drive trust and usability.

This role combines creative experience design with hands-on prototyping and UX engineering, working closely with robotics and software teams to bring intuitive interactions to life.

The initial contract is for 6 months. When applying, please include your portfolio

What You’ll Do

  • Contribute to end to end design of human–robot interaction behaviors
  • Prototype interactions directly on real robot hardware
  • Define standards for gestures, motion, communication cues, and user safety
  • Work closely with engineering to translate designs into implemented behaviors
  • Develop UI, conversation flows, and tools that support human-robot collaboration
  • Conduct user research and testing to validate designs and approaches
  • Ability to read academic papers and translate research findings into actionable HRI design criteria, not relying on AI summaries

We’re Looking For

  • 7–10 years experience in interaction design, UX for robotics, HRI, or similar fields
  • Highly preferable experience or track record designing for embodied agents and AI products
  • Strong prototyping skills, alongside proven expertise in hardware interaction and digital product design
  • Experienced in documenting & maintaining Design System
  • Comfortable working hands-on with hardware and in lab environments
  • Experience in microcontroller prototyping, motion design (After Effects), and writing technical design specifications
  • Figma design asset creation and maintenance
  • An experienced design track record demonstrating success in high-impact projects
  • Deep understanding of HCI principles, human behavior, and user safety
  • Able to operate independently and bridge design + engineering workflows
  • Strong collaboration and communication skills across multi-disciplinary teams
  • An eye for a well crafted design outcome
  • A self-starter who understands priority management and consistently meets delivery milestones on time
